Illinois Compiled Statutes 705 ILCS 25 Appellate Court Act. Section 8.2

    (705 ILCS 25/8.2) (from Ch. 37, par. 32.2)

    Sec. 8.2. Appeals from the appellate court shall lie to the Supreme Court as a matter of right only (a) in cases in which a question under the Constitution of the United States or of this state arises for the first time in and as a result of the action of the appellate court, and (b) upon the certification by a division of the appellate court that a case decided by it involves a question of such importance that it should be decided by the Supreme Court. The Supreme Court may provide by rule for appeals from the appellate court in other cases.

(Source: P.A. 79-1360.)
